How to Add a Downloadable File to a Product in WooCommerce

Transcript (Modified for Flow)

In this video, I’m going to cover how to add a download to your WooCommerce product so that when your clients purchase your download, they’re able to download it immediately from their order details. The first thing that you want to do is log into the backend of your website, which I’ve done here already on a website. You’re going to come to the media section and click on, add new. There are multiple ways to accomplish the same thing, but for the sake of this video, I’m going to cover this method because it’s the cleanest. It’s going to bring you to this upload new media page, where you can either drop files to upload, or you can select them. The select option is going to open up a window where you can search your website, find the file that you need, and select it. I’m going to use the drop files method because I know exactly where my file is, and I’m going to drop it in the box here. You can see that it is uploading, and we just need to wait for it to complete.

Once it’s completely loaded, it’s going to show up in your standard media library with all of your other types of media files, images, um, occasionally a video or audio, although I do recommend other storage space for both of those is they can significantly slow down your site and you definitely don’t want to be storing a lot of those types of files on here. PDFs are another common one. We’re all loaded up here and we’re going to click on the edit button so that we can get to the details of this file. This is the location of the file on your website.

You’re going to go ahead and copy the URL to the clipboard. And then we’re going to go ahead and update this. Then we’re going to go down to WooCommerce and then to all products. We’re going to find the product that we need and go into edit. Then we’re going to scroll down and you want to make sure that you have created this product as a downloadable file. Then you’ll see here where it says download files. You’re going to click and we’re going to start here so that I don’t lose the link. I’m going to copy and paste the information in there. You can also do a search, but I find this to be a little bit quicker. And then we are going to copy this.

That’s it! So once you have that all set up, when they place their order it’s going to include a link to this item here where they can download right away. It’s a nice way to automate the process.

